Assessing Your Home's Solar Possible
Before diving into solar panel setup, you need to evaluate your home's solar capacity. Start by examining your roofing system's orientation and slope; south-facing roofing systems generally capture one of the most sunshine.
Look for any type of blockages, like trees or tall structures, that could cast darkness on your panels. These can significantly minimize power manufacturing. Consider your local climate as well; warm locations produce better results than constantly cloudy regions.

Panel Effectiveness Rankings
As you discover the world of solar panels, recognizing panel effectiveness rankings is critical for making an informed choice. These rankings suggest how successfully a panel converts sunlight into usable electricity. The greater the performance, the much more energy you'll create from a smaller area. The majority of property panels vary from 15% to 22% efficiency.
When choosing your panels, consider your energy demands and readily available roof area. If you have restricted space, opting for higher-efficiency panels could be useful. However, if you have adequate roof area, lower-efficiency panels may be enough.
Installation Type Options
Choosing the right setup type for solar panels can considerably affect your system's performance and performance. You'll generally run into 2 major options: roof-mounted and ground-mounted systems.
Roof-mounted panels are typically the best choice for homeowners, as they utilize existing space and can be cheaper to mount. However, if your roofing system isn't appropriate-- possibly due to shading or structural issues-- ground-mounted systems could be the better option.
They allow for ideal positioning, making the most of sunlight exposure. Additionally, you can readjust their angle to enhance performance.
Prior to making a decision, think about aspects like readily available room, budget, and neighborhood regulations. By reviewing these choices meticulously, you'll ensure your solar panel installation fulfills your energy needs efficiently.
Aesthetic Factors to consider
While capability is essential, appearances should not be forgotten when selecting solar panels for your home. You want panels that not only work properly yet also complement your home's design.
Think about the color and size of the solar panels; black panels typically blend seamlessly with dark roof coverings, while blue panels could stand apart more. Explore options like building-integrated photovoltaics (BIPV) that replace typical roof covering products, using a smooth appearance.
You might additionally check out solar shingles, which simulate standard roof covering and can boost curb charm. Don't neglect to assess the layout and placement of the panels to maximize both effectiveness and visual harmony.
